You're confusing accessibility with difficulty. A game can be accessible and hard at the same time. Saying that putting together a group should be as difficult as possible does not make the actual content more challenging, it only makes the entire process frustrating. For example, it would be akin to someone saying configurable UI and key binding should not be in the game because it makes things "too easy".I grew up always having to give my very best, and the game just feels like its promoting laziness as best as it can X: Duty Finder...? yes its handy but thanks to how accessable it is, it has smited down the very idea of this game ever having the chance of people needing to communicate.
The bit about negating the need for communication also doesn't pan out. What exactly does DF do that gets rid of the need to communicate?
